Air leaks and/or a lean fuel mixture are the two biggest causes of burned pistons. Race-Driven recommends the following preliminary work to be performed by a qualified mechanic prior installing new pistons. Customer Driven Quality Race-Driven. If the old piston has failed, determine cause and remedy problem before replacing.
